What is School Meals Application

The 2015-2016 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als is a financial aid document used by households in the United States to apply for free or reduced-price meals for their children.

Comprehensive Guide to School Meals Application

What is the 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als?

The 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als is an essential form in the U.S. educational system that allows households to apply for nutritional support for their children. Through this application, families can access free and reduced-price meals, ensuring that their children receive the nutrition necessary for learning and development. Understanding how school meals applications function helps parents navigate the process effectively.

Purpose and Benefits of the 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als

This application serves a significant purpose by helping families secure access to vital nutrition for their children, which is crucial for their physical and educational growth. Receiving free or reduced-price meals can have a positive impact on educational outcomes, including improved concentration and enhanced academic performance. Understanding the benefits of the financial aid application provides parents with the clarity needed for enrollment.

Who Needs to Complete the 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als?

The target audience for the 2 Application primarily includes parents and guardians of school-aged children. Households that meet specific income guidelines based on family size are eligible to apply. It is vital for applicants to understand the household income form and eligibility criteria to ensure accurate submissions.

Eligibility Criteria for the 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als

Eligibility for the application depends on various factors, including family income levels and household size. Applicants must meet income thresholds that comply with federal guidelines. Additionally, participation in other assistance programs may provide an easier pathway to eligibility for reduced price meals. Knowing the state-specific rules can further refine the application process.

Common Errors and How to Avoid Them When Completing the Application

Applicants often make common errors that can lead to delays or rejections. Frequent mistakes include:
  • Incorrect income reporting or omissions.
  • Failure to include signatures where required.
  • Not updating household information accurately.
To avoid these mistakes, it is essential to have a review and validation checklist that can help double-check the inputted information.

How to Submit the 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als

Submitting the application can be done through various methods including online, by mail, or in person. Interested individuals should pay attention to specific deadlines for submission to avoid missing out on participation. Late filings may have implications on eligibility for free meals application status.

What Happens After You Submit the 2 Application for Free and Reduced Price School Meals?

After submission, the application will undergo a processing period during which applicants can track their submissions. Notifications regarding approval or rejection will be sent to the provided contact information. Being aware of common rejection reasons can help applicants avoid pitfalls in future applications.

Eligibility typically includes households whose income meets or falls below federal guidelines. Visit your local school district's website for specific income thresholds and additional requirements.
Applications for the 2015-2016 school year should generally be submitted as early as possible at the start of the school year. Check with your school for any specific deadlines.
Completed applications can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ller, printed and mailed to the school's administrative office, or delivered in person at the school.
Commonly required documents include proof of income, such as pay stubs, assistance program verification, and identification of household members. Ensure all relevant documents are ready when filling out the form.
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ately. Double-check household income entries and make sure to sign the application to avoid delays.
Processing times can vary, but typically you should expect to receive notification within a few weeks. Follow up with the school if you have not heard back.
Once submitted, you may need to contact the school directly to make changes. It's best to review all information carefully before you submit the application.
